In this episode of "Bonding Through Home Chores," we dive into the world of home repair projects, discovering how to transform them into memorable family activities that foster skill-building and connection. Join us as we explore practical tips for involving your kids in handy tasks, from simple repairs to DIY projects, all while teaching them valuable life skills. Discover how these hands-on experiences not only boost your children's independence but also deepen the bond between you and your little ones. With easy-to-follow advice tailored for busy fathers, you’ll learn to make home repairs enjoyable and educational, turning chores into cherished family moments. Whether you’re fixing a leaky faucet or tackling a small renovation, this episode equips you with the strategies to engage your kids in a meaningful way, helping to create a lifetime of shared experiences and memories.
